Coal-fired power generation in Germany hit a one-year high this week as renewable energy output continues to struggle amid low wind speeds. German coal power plants generated 8.1 gigawatts (GW) of electricity on Thursday, the highest since February 2024, Bloomberg models showed, despite growing wind power capacity over the past year. Wind capacity is higher but wind power generation has been lower since the autumn of 2024 as wind speeds have plunged.
